Fuel Tax Cut Benefits Not Fully Passed To Consumers
Oil companies apparently did not fully pass on the fuel tax discount to drivers on the day of its introduction. Due to the tax reduction, gasoline and diesel should have cost around 17 cents less. However, according to the ADAC, they were only about 13 cents cheaper nationwide.

Paralympic Athlete Overcomes Severe Accidents
An athlete survived two serious accidents, including one in 2001 that resulted in the loss of both legs. Despite this, the individual pursued a career in Paralympic handbike sports, achieving multiple titles and records. A subsequent severe accident occurred on June 19, 2020.

Germany Considers Deutschland-Ticket Improvements
Following the three-year anniversary of the Deutschland-Ticket, new proposals have emerged. Municipalities and associations are calling for improvements to public transport, including more lines and tighter schedules. The Germany-Ticket was introduced three years ago.
